VB问题:关于DriveListBox的疑问!

Private Sub Drive1_Change()
Dir1.Path = Drive1.Drive
End Sub
假设现在我的电脑里硬盘是C、D、E, F是光驱,当我运行这个VB 6.0程序的时候,在驱动器列表中选择F盘时,就会弹出:Device unavailable,那这个问题该怎样解决,可不可以这样:当我选择F的时候就弹出对话框:你的光驱里头没有东西!

请问高手,这该如何实现?

Private Sub Drive1_Change()
On Error GoTo strs
Dir1.Path = Drive1.Drive
Exit Sub
strs:
MsgBox "没有东西"
End Sub
温馨提示:答案为网友推荐,仅供参考
第1个回答  2008-03-25
这就涉及到一个出错处理,我没有尝试过,相信上面那位的答案是正确的
相似回答
大家正在搜